Features of 17-4 PH Stainless Steel Shapes

17-4 PH stainless steel forms exhibit a distinctive combination of mechanical and corrosion resistance properties. These features are a result of its makeup, which primarily includes chromium, nickel, and copper along with added precipitation hardening elements such as molybdenum and nitrogen. This alloy exhibits high tensile strength, yield strength, and hardness due to its ability to undergo age hardening treatment. The material's resistance to corrosion is exceptional, particularly against various acids, alkalis, and chloride environments. 17-4 PH stainless steel shows excellent weldability and can be readily machined, formed, and fabricated into diverse shapes.

  • The high strength-to-weight ratio of 17-4 PH stainless steel makes it suitable for applications where lightweight construction is crucial.
  • Moreover, its resistance to stress corrosion cracking makes it an ideal choice for demanding environments.
